People with low mental well-being benefit most from psychedelics, new study states
More than 80% of participants said they usually took LSD or psilocybin [mushrooms] at home, while more than half of participants said they used ayahuasca in a ceremonial or spiritual ritual setting. MDMA was usually used at a festival or party.
[Re-creational] users of psychedelics… with low well-being are more likely than those with normal well-being to experience a positive mood change after taking LSD, psilocybin, or MDMA, according to new research published in the journal Drug Science, Policy and Law; has uncovered some interesting information surrounding psychedelic drug use and psychological well-being. Based on the questionnaire, 1,324 participants were classified as having normal well-being while 643 participants were classified as having low well-being.
